Jeff Yass is a co-founder of Susquehanna International Group (SIG), a major global trading and market-making firm. SIG is known for options expertise, quantitative trading, and a training culture grounded in probabilistic decision-making. Yass’s firm is influential across derivatives markets even though it is less of a traditional long-only stock-picking franchise.

Jeff Yass's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2025, Jeff Yass held 14,094 positions worth $868B, down 0.79% from $875B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 24% of the portfolio.

Jeff Yass's Q4 2025 filing shows 1,864 new, 4,890 increased, 5,380 reduced and 1,914 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ares Core MSCI Total International Stock ETF: 1,468,872 shares worth $124M. The largest sale was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$2.08B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 94% of assets, down from 94%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.
